Dr. Jim Lewis, a distinguished fellow at the Center for European Policy Analysis, shares his insights on the U.S. AI strategy and the impact of technology investment cuts on national security. He discusses the ambitious Stargate Project and the competitive landscape with China, including issues of talent retention. Additionally, Lewis delves into the significance of quantum technologies tested aboard the X-37B and the alarming breach of Microsoft servers tied to U.S. nuclear data, emphasizing the urgent need for stronger cybersecurity measures.

US AI Leadership Strategy
- The US must focus on building AI infrastructure and technology to lead the next industrial revolution.
- Generating technology foundations translates directly into economic and strategic leadership.
AI Leadership is Not Monopoly
- The US leads in AI due to more researchers, capital, and innovation but is not a monopoly.
- AI innovation is global with countries like France, Germany, and China also advancing technologies.
Restricting Tech Won't Stop China
- Blocking AI chip exports to China raises costs but won't stop their progress.
- US challenges lie more in broken acquisition and strategy processes than raw technology restriction.
